Ingredients
– 1 pound dried pasta such as fusilli, penne, rotini, or farfalle
– 1 cup sliced bell pepper about 1 medium
– 1 cup thinly sliced zucchini about 1/2 medium
– 1 cup halved cherry tomatoes
– 1/3 cup thinly sliced green onions about 5 to 6 green onions
– 1/4 cup sliced pepperoncini or banana peppers optional
– 1 cup 4 ounces halved mixed olives
– 1 cup 2 ounces grated parmesan cheese or other hard cheese
– 1 cup 6 ounces fresh mozzarella balls, chopped
– 1/3 cup fresh parsley or basil optional
– 1/3 cup red wine vinegar, white wine vinegar, or champagne vinegar
– 1/2 teaspoon fine sea salt plus more to taste
– 1/2 teaspoon fresh ground black pepper
– 1/2 teaspoon dried oregano
– 2 to 3 tablespoons juice from pepperoncini jar optional
– 1/2 cup extra-virgin olive oil
Instructions
1-First, bring a large pot of salted water to a boil and cook the pasta according to package instructions until al dente, typically 8-10 minutes, then drain and rinse under cold water to stop cooking and keep the texture firm.
2-Second, prepare all vegetables by washing them thoroughly; slice the bell pepper, zucchini, cherry tomatoes, green onions, and any optional peppers.
3-Third, in a large bowl, combine the cooled pasta with the prepared vegetables for even mixing.
4-Fourth, add the olives, cheeses, and herbs, then pour in the homemade dressing and toss gently to coat everything without mashing the ingredients.
5-Fifth, taste the mixture and adjust seasoning with more salt, pepper, or herbs as needed.
6-Finally, let the salad chill in the fridge for at least 30 minutes to let the flavors blend, and remember to adapt for dietary needs by swapping ingredients like the cheese or pasta as mentioned earlier.
